On April 20, the International Symposium on "Digital Transformation Reshaping Lifelong Learning for All" was held in Shanghai. Chen Jie, Vice Minister of Education and Director of the China National Commission for UNESCO, attended the opening ceremony and delivered a speech: China is actively building and continuously optimizing a lifelong learning system for all, building a national smart education platform, providing high-quality digital learning resources to the whole society, and promoting learning The construction of large-scale units, enterprises, communities and learning cities, the establishment of the National University for the Elderly to help the elderly learn, and actively participate in international exchanges and cooperation in lifelong learning.
